A gap between the sash's frame and the frame could be the cause of your windows that are not closing properly. This problem can cause draughts, however it could also cause water damage and damp. To determine this, try putting a piece of paper between the frame and the sash to see if it can be closed.

To repair it, you'll have to take off the seals surrounding the frame and the sash. Then, you will need to remove the gearbox that locks from its position within the frame. This will require the assistance of a tool, such as a flat screwdriver as well as a torch to access it. After removing the gearbox you will need to replace it with one that is identical in size and design.

UPVC window frame repair

It is essential to repair any holes, cracks or broken seals on your uPVC Windows as quickly as you can. These problems can cause the glass to become cloudy, and they may also result in water leaks. The frames may also become damaged, reducing insulation value and increasing energy bills. Fortunately, the majority of these problems can be repaired with some basic DIY repairs or hiring a skilled professional.

UPVC window repair is more cost-effective than replacing the entire window, however there are some cases where it's better to replace the entire unit. This is especially true if the frame is damaged beyond repair. There are a variety of factors that affect the cost of UPVC window replacement, such as the type of material and the amount of work involved. A full replacement costs between $100 and $1000 per window, and the cost will vary depending on the extent of the damage and if a new installation is required.

It is essential to clean UPVC windows regularly to prevent the accumulation of dirt and moisture. This will save you from costly repairs in the future. You should perform this at least twice every year. You could also use WD-40 for lubricating the moving parts of your UPVC windows. Before cleaning the frame, you should be sure to remove any dust or cobwebs with a soft bristle brush. You can also sand any scuff marks on frames to make them look like new.
